為瞭滿足顧客日新月異的需求,現代面包店正在嘗試制作各種各樣不同口味的面包。面包師們不但開始嘗試使用味噌、開心果甚至活性炭等新材料來為面包增加不同的口味,他們還通過結合兩種面包的特點等方式來創造新產品。除此之外,面包店也在不斷適應著人們對本地購買、可持續性包裝和環保配送方式的新要求。本文淺談現代面包店的種種創新方式。

1 Move over Victoria sponge cake. Modern bakeries are trending – delivering fresh flavours and celebrating independence.
2 Hybrid creations are becoming increasingly common. On a trip to the bakery, you could come across a cronut or a duffin, and Coyle’s Bakeshop in Seattle, USA sells cretzels – a cross between a croissant and a pretzel. They’re made of croissant dough, shaped like a pretzel and sprinkled with sea salt. Popular too are cakesicles, crumbled sponge mixed with frosting on a stick, and donut holes, a small round piece of donut dough that could fill the hole in a typical donut, hence the name.
3 And it’s not just creations that are changing – new ingredients are taking hold too. At the London-based bakery British Patagonia, you can tuck into a peanut, caramel and miso cookie – miso is typically a savoury Asian flavour. While there you could also have the nutty ‘sticky pistachio’ – a bake made from pistachio paste and pistachio ganache. Activated charcoal sourdough bread can frequently be found in bakeries too. Aside from being strikingly black, adding charcoal makes no change to the flavour of the bread because it’s essentially tasteless and odourless. And turmeric lattes are also commonplace these days, if you fancy a healthy drink alongside a bite to eat.
4 Bakeries are also embracing dietary inclusivity and sustainability. Pink Lane Bakery in Newcastle delivers bakes to customers via electric van and cargo bikes, and their website states they take care to ensure their packaging is ‘as recyclable as possible’. Consumers are increasingly choosing to buy more local and unique products by turning to independent bakeries. According to industry magazine Food and Beverage Business, ‘This preference for artisanal options has driven the growth of independent bakery sales, which are expected to rise by 25.3% this year, reaching £1.6 billion.’
5 So, try a new flavour and shop local. Who knows what new trend is around the corner.
